#656a54 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#656a54 is composed of 39.6% red, 41.6%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 73.6 degrees, a saturation of 11.6% and a lightness of 37.3%. #656a54 color hex could be obtained by blending #cad4a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070806 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#61635b is the less saturated color, while #91ba04 is the most saturated one.
